Code P0791 2015 Toyota RAV4 Description
The P0791 code on a 2015 Toyota RAV4 relates to the Intermediate Shaft Speed Sensor 'A' Circuit. This sensor plays a crucial role in monitoring the speed of the intermediate shaft in the transmission. The sensor sends signals to the vehicle's engine control module (ECM) to ensure that the transmission shifts smoothly and efficiently. When this sensor malfunctions or fails, it can lead to various issues with the vehicle's performance, including erratic shifting, harsh shifting, transmission slippage, and even transmission failure.
Common Causes of P0791 2015 Toyota RAV4
- Faulty Intermediate Shaft Speed Sensor
- Wiring or connector issues related to the sensor
- ECM software or programming issues
- Mechanical issues within the transmission
- Electrical problems within the transmission control module
Symptoms of P0791 2015 Toyota RAV4
- Erratic shifting behavior
- Harsh or delayed shifting
- Transmission slippage
- Illuminated Check Engine Light
- Reduced fuel efficiency
How to Fix P0791 2015 Toyota RAV4
- Use a diagnostic scanner to retrieve the trouble code and confirm the issue.
- Inspect the wiring and connectors associated with the Intermediate Shaft Speed Sensor for any damage or corrosion.
- Test the sensor's functionality using a multimeter to determine if it is faulty.
- Replace the Intermediate Shaft Speed Sensor if it is found to be defective.
- Clear the trouble code from the ECM and test drive the vehicle to ensure the issue is resolved.
Cost to Fix P0791 2015 Toyota RAV4
The typical repair costs for addressing a P0791 code on a 2015 Toyota RAV4 can range from $150 to $400, depending on the cost of the sensor and the labor involved in the repair. It is essential to consider that diagnosis time and labor rates at auto repair shops can vary based on location, vehicle make and model, and engine type. Rates can range from $80 to $150 per hour, with rates potentially higher at dealerships or in metropolitan areas.
